At the subway arches of the Alexander Square you will find a museum that is the first of its kind in the German capital: The first DDR motorbike museum.
The man who had this idea was the 51-year old Uwe Kobilke who collected 80 scooters, motorbikes and mopeds in only 3 years time. Today, some of them are older than 50 years! Even more surprising is that some of them are still able to drive! They were all restored by Kobilke and he knows everything about every single motorbike. Now he is very proud to present his work to everyone else. Therefore, he puts loads of money and effort in it and even mixed the paints until he created the original ones. There is also one motorbike that belonged to a government escort of the earlier politician Erich Honecker. On its wind deflector you can still see the original emblem of the DDR.

Even before the museum opened on the 27th of September, there was loads of interest in the motorbikes: People that really wanted to have a look at them maybe because these motorbikes refreshed people’s memory?!
Now, there are 80 scooters, motorbikes and mopeds on 800 square meters on 2 floors.

If you want to visit the museum, come to Rochstraße 14 c. It is open every day from 10am until 9pm and it costs 5,50Euro (4,50Euro with abatement).

This museum is great no only for those who are really interested in motorbikes. It is very interesting to see the history of all of them and to see how much effort Uwe Kobilke put in.
